Abdominoplasty Myths Debunked: What's Reality and What's Fiction?

The world of cosmetic surgery is filled with misconceptions and myths that can cloud the minds of potential patients. Among these, the tummy tuck-- formally referred to as abdominoplasty-- sticks out as a treatment surrounded by both intrigue and false information. This short article aims to clarify, supplying insight into common myths associated with tummy tucks while distinguishing truth from fiction.

What Is a Belly Tuck?

A tummy tuck, or abdominoplasty, is a surgical procedure targeted at eliminating excess skin and fat from the abdominal location. It also involves tightening up the underlying muscles to create a flatter, firmer abdominal areas. This operation is particularly popular among people who have actually experienced considerable weight-loss or females who have gone through pregnancy.

Tummy Tuck Myths Unmasked: What's Truth and What's Fiction?

Many people keep misconceptions about tummy tucks that can hinder them from seeking this life-altering surgical treatment. Let's take a better take a look at a few of these myths.

Myth 1: An Abdominoplasty Is Just for Weight Loss

Fact: While lots of associate tummy tucks with weight-loss, they are not intended to be a primary method for slimming down. The perfect candidates are those who are close to their target weight however battle with excess skin or muscle separation.

Myth 2: A Tummy Tuck Is Just for Women

Fact: Though typically performed on females post-pregnancy, tummy tucks are significantly sought after by males also. Male prospects may go with the procedure to get rid of stubborn abdominal fat or loose skin after substantial weight loss.

Myth 3: An Abdominoplasty Leaves Unattractive Scars

Fact: While it is true that scarring takes place as part of any surgical procedure, knowledgeable surgeons utilize methods aimed at decreasing noticeable scars. In addition, scars tend tummy tuck consultation guidelines to fade gradually and can frequently be hidden below clothing.

Myth 4: You Can't Get Pregnant After a Stomach Tuck

Fact: Although it's recommended to finish your family before undergoing a tummy tuck since future pregnancies can alter results, getting pregnant post-surgery is completely possible. Nevertheless, the appearance of your abdomen may change.

Myth 5: Healing Is Quick and Painless

Fact: The recovery period differs per person; however, it's important to understand that tummy tucks require substantial downtime. Clients need to expect some pain throughout healing and adhere strictly to their cosmetic surgeon's post-operative care instructions.

Myth 6: Liposuction Is Better Than a Belly Tuck

Fact: Liposuction and abdominoplasty serve various functions. Liposuction gets rid of fat however does not resolve excess skin or muscle tightening up. In cases where both issues are present, doctors may advise combining treatments for optimum results.

  • Exploring Various Kinds of Abdominoplasty Procedures

    Tummy tucks aren't one-size-fits-all; numerous strategies cater to different requirements:

    Full Abdominoplasty

    This involves making a cut from hip bone to hip bone throughout the lower abdominal area while transferring the stubborn belly button for a natural appearance.

    Mini Abdominoplasty

    Ideal for those with minimal excess skin below the navel; this includes smaller sized incisions and quicker healing times.

    Extended Abdominoplasty

    Recommended for clients needing more extensive work done on both the abdominal area and flanks (sides).

  • FAQ Section

    Here are some regularly asked concerns associated to tummy tucks along with concise responses:

    1. The length of time does it take to recover from a stomach tuck?

    Recovery usually takes about 6 weeks; however, complete results may not show up up until swelling subsides completely.

    2. Will I have noticeable scars after my stomach tuck?

    While scarring is inescapable post-surgery, experienced surgeons aim to position incisions in less noticeable locations that fade over time.

    3. Can I combine liposuction with my tummy tuck?

    Yes! Numerous surgeons carry out both procedures at the same time depending upon specific requirements and goals.

    4. Is there an ideal weight variety before undergoing this surgery?

    Candidates should preferably be within 10-15 pounds of their objective weight before considering this procedure.

    5. Are there non-surgical alternatives available?

    Non-invasive choices such as CoolSculpting exist however frequently do not yield comparable outcomes as surgical methods like abdominoplasty do when attending to loose skin or muscle separation effectively.

    What is a Tummy Tuck? A Tummy Tuck (abdominoplasty) is a surgical procedure that removes excess skin and fat from the abdomen and tightens the underlying muscles to achieve a more toned, sculpted midsection.

    What is the difference between a Tummy Tuck and abdominoplasty? There is no difference—“Tummy Tuck” and “abdominoplasty” are interchangeable terms for the same procedure that removes excess abdominal skin and tightens muscles for improved contour.

    Who is a good candidate for a Tummy Tuck? Individuals with loose or sagging abdominal skin and weakened muscles—typically after pregnancy or weight loss—are good candidates for a Tummy Tuck to restore a firmer, flatter abdomen.

    Are men candidates for Tummy Tuck? Yes, men—especially after major weight loss—can benefit from a Tummy Tuck to correct excess skin, stubborn fat pockets, and sagging muscle for a flatter abdomen.

    How long do Tummy Tuck results last? Tummy Tuck results can be long-lasting, provided you maintain a stable weight; small fluctuations are acceptable, but significant changes may alter the outcome.

    Will I have scars after a Tummy Tuck? Yes, scarring is expected; however, incisions are placed strategically for discreet healing and post‑surgical treatments can help minimize their appearance.

    Do I need to stop medications like Ozempic before a Tummy Tuck? Yes, patients are typically asked to stop GLP‑1 medications (like Ozempic) a couple of weeks before surgery and follow a clear liquid diet the day before to ensure safety during anesthesia.

    Can Tummy Tuck be included in a Mommy Makeover? Yes, a Tummy Tuck is commonly combined with breast surgery and liposuction in a Mommy Makeover to restore body shape after pregnancy.

    What can be combined with a Tummy Tuck for body contouring? Body contouring often combines Tummy Tuck with liposuction, as well as other procedures depending on individual goals for comprehensive transformation.
